Sis. Kimberly was born in Oscoda, MI. Her parents took her to church from the time she was born. She grew up in Pasadena, TX and Marshalltown, IA, and graduated from the University of Dubuque in Dubuque, IA.
Sis. Kimberly likes grammar, learning new languages, studying other cultures, world geography, and reading. She also enjoys business writing and creating resumes. Employed as an educational coordinator by Manasseh House/Operation Empower, Sis. Kimberly works to empower low- to medium-income women who live at Manasseh House. A life-long student of the Word of God, Sis. Kimberly enjoys teaching Bible studies. She also is a musician in the church.
Missions has been a part of her life since she was a child. Sis. Kimberly was always drawn to foreign languages, other cultures, missions, people from other countries, and ministry. Missionary work around the world is her passion and is driven to promote the work of God going on in the world. She thinks missionaries are very special people!
The vision of the Missions/Multicultural Ministries is to equip the members of Faith Temple UPC with the necessary tools and opportunities to disciple our world for Jesus Christ.
